Good morning from N Wales UK, in 1994 a Sunbeam Tiger came to the UK,I bought it in 2004,it has on its reg document 289 engine, I have often wondered if any history about in SA (have no SA reg number),I started to look the engine numbers recently, discovered D20E-6015-AB which is a 302,also the reg document records the engine number as 386 which is odd, it has an alloy high rise manifold, and was told it was bought to uk with "hotter cams". The Tiger has had modification to panel ,under the bumper to aid cooling, it was originally white now red
Could this engine have come from a Ford Capri V8 Perana??
I know this is a massive shot in the dark but would be very grateful for any thoughts/history etc

Does the engine number have BG before the 386? If not it won't be a Perana engine.
I think new imported unstamped engines were given a number by the Traffic Department but I think there was a logo included.

Looking at the engine from the passenger side of the car the number will be on a flat horizontal section at the rear of the block at the rear of the head at the place where the bellhousing is bolted on. Hope that makes sense.
